About Tetsuo II: Body Hammer
Tetsuo II: Body Hammer is a 1992 Japanese-language science fiction, horror and drama film directed by Shinya Tsukamoto. The cast is led by Tomorowo Taguchi, Shinya Tsukamoto, Nobu Kanaoka. It has a runtime of 1h 21m. Viewers rate it 6.3/10 across 100 ratings. In United States, it is currently streaming on YouTube TV, Fandor Amazon Channel, Screambox Amazon Channel.
Tetsuo II: Body Hammer was produced by Kaijyu Theater and Toshiba EMI and made in Japan. It was released on October 3, 1992.

Tetsuo II: Body Hammer cast & crew
Tetsuo II: Body Hammer was directed by Shinya Tsukamoto and written by Shinya Tsukamoto.
The cast features Tomorowo Taguchi as Taniguchi Tomoo, Shinya Tsukamoto as Yatsu - The Guy, Nobu Kanaoka as Kana, Kim Soo-jin as Taniguchi's Father, Hideaki Tezuka as Big Skinhead, and Tomoo Asada as Young Skinhead.
Behind the camera, the score was composed by Chu Ishikawa, cinematography is by Katsunori Yokoyama, and it was produced by Fuminori Shishido and Nobuo Takeuchi.
